The Traxxas Slayer Pro 4X4 is a 1/10 scale nitro-powered short course racing truck featuring a powerful TRX 3.3 engine, 4WD with 2-speed transmission, and a top speed of 50 mph. It includes Traxxas Stability Management for superior handling, a durable blue-anodized aluminum chassis, and an advanced TQi 2.4GHz transmitter with Bluetooth tuning capabilities. Ready-to-race out of the box with EZ-Start and fast charger, it combines authentic race replica styling with professional-grade performance for serious RC enthusiasts.

Great car once you do a brushless conversion. 3.3 engine is problematic
Ran 4 of the 5 break in tanks just as stated by the manufacturer. I monitored the temps and made sure it produced plenty of smoke for the break in. Halfway through the 5th tank the engine shut off to never restart again no matter what I tried. Discovered the engine had developed a massive air leak. There is no warranty on their engines so I spent another 350 to do a brushless conversion and ditch that garbage engine. With a 4s battery and a 2200k brushless, this thing now rips as it should. I did my research on the 3.3 engine and about half the people hate it and half love it. I personally think the 3.3 is an unreliable engine. Especially compared to my gt2 that still has the original engine and has about 10 gallons of 33% run through it.
